British Pride organizations have called on LGBTQ+ venues to boycott Nicki Minaj following her recent comments.

On December 21st, the rapper appeared on stage at Turning Point USA’s America Fest and spoke with Erica Kirk, the widow of Charlie Kirk.

During the conversation, Minaj gave her full support to the “handsome and dashing” President Trump and Vice President J.D. Vance, and referred to MAGA supporters as “cool kids.”

The 12-time Grammy nominee also doubled down on her Opposition He urged California Governor Gavin Newsom to encourage young boys to be more masculine, citing his support for transgender youth.

“Boys, be boys…it’s okay. Be boys. There’s nothing wrong with being a boy…how powerful is that? How profound is that? Boys will continue to be boys and there’s nothing wrong with that,” he told the audience.

Her comments sent fans into a frenzy, especially those within the LGBTQ+ community.

On December 24, an account called @prideukorg took to social media to slam the rapper and urge LGBTQ+ venues to boycott Minaj.

“To all LGBTQ+ venues… please refrain from playing Nicki Minaj’s music. She is not our friend.” #boycottnikiminajiThe post has been viewed more than 1.7 million times and has more than 19,000 likes.
